Nestled along the picturesque Gaspé Peninsula in Quebec, Canada, lies the charming town of Cap-Chat. Surrounded by breathtaking natural beauty, this coastal community is a paradise for outdoor enthusiasts and lovers of scenic landscapes.
Founded in 1866, Cap-Chat has a rich history that is deeply intertwined with its geographical location. The town takes its name from the nearby Cap-Chat River, which means “sealing cape” in the Micmac language. Early European settlers were drawn to the area due to its abundant fishing resources and stunning coastal setting.
As you explore Cap-Chat, you’ll be captivated by its unique blend of rugged wilderness and welcoming community spirit. The town’s population of around 2,500 residents remains dedicated to preserving the area’s natural heritage while embracing sustainable development.
One of Cap-Chat’s most notable landmarks is the Parc éolien de Cap-Chat, the first wind farm established in Canada. Situated on a wind-swept plateau, this renewable energy project showcases the town’s commitment to green initiatives and the promotion of clean, sustainable practices.
For outdoor enthusiasts, Cap-Chat offers a wide range of activities to enjoy throughout the year. During the warmer months, visitors can explore the pristine hiking trails that wind through the surrounding mountains, immersing themselves in lush greenery and breathtaking vistas. The region is also renowned for its excellent fishing, with the Cap-Chat River providing opportunities for anglers to reel in salmon and trout.
Winter brings a whole new set of adventures to Cap-Chat. The nearby Gaspésie National Park offers endless opportunities for snowshoeing, cross-country skiing, and snowmobiling through snow-covered forests and majestic mountains. The region’s reliable snowfall makes it a popular destination for winter sports enthusiasts.
